.elementor-13 .elementor-element.elementor-element-027ce10 {--display: flex;--flex-direction: row;--container-widget-width: calc(( 1 - var(--container-widget-flex-grow) ) * 100%);--container-widget-height: 100%;--container-widget-flex-grow: 1;--container-widget-align-self: stretch;--flex-wrap-mobile: wrap;--align-items: center;--gap: 0px 0px;--row-gap: 0px;--column-gap: 0px;}
.elementor-13 .elementor-element.elementor-element-027ce10:not(.elementor-motion-effects-element-type-background), .elementor-13 .elementor-element.elementor-element-027ce10 > .elementor-motion-effects-container > .elementor-motion-effects-layer {background-color: #fff;}
.elementor-13 .elementor-element.elementor-element-c6832b6 {--display: flex;--flex-direction: column;--container-widget-width: 100%;--container-widget-height: initial;--container-widget-flex-grow: 0;--container-widget-align-self: initial;--flex-wrap-mobile: wrap;}
.elementor-widget-heading .elementor-heading-title {font-family: var(--e-global-typography-primary-font-family),Sans-serif;font-weight: var(--e-global-typography-primary-font-weight);color: var(--e-global-color-primary);}
.elementor-13 .elementor-element.elementor-element-8376cf5 {margin: 0px 0px calc(var(--kit-widget-spacing,0px) + 0px) 0px;}
.elementor-13 .elementor-element.elementor-element-8376cf5 .elementor-heading-title {font-family: "Rajdhani",Sans-serif;font-size: 24px;font-weight: 600;color: #000;}
.elementor-widget-icon-list .elementor-icon-list-item:not(:last-child):after {border-color: var(--e-global-color-text);}
.elementor-widget-icon-list .elementor-icon-list-icon i {color: var(--e-global-color-primary);}
.elementor-widget-icon-list .elementor-icon-list-icon svg {fill: var(--e-global-color-primary);}
.elementor-widget-icon-list .elementor-icon-list-item > .elementor-icon-list-text, .elementor-widget-icon-list .elementor-icon-list-item > a {font-family: var(--e-global-typography-text-font-family),Sans-serif;font-weight: var(--e-global-typography-text-font-weight);}
.elementor-widget-icon-list .elementor-icon-list-text {color: var(--e-global-color-secondary);}
.elementor-13 .elementor-element.elementor-element-803edf7 {margin: -10px 0px calc(var(--kit-widget-spacing,0px) + 0px) 0px;--e-icon-list-icon-size: 17px;--icon-vertical-offset: 0px;}
.elementor-13 .elementor-element.elementor-element-803edf7 .elementor-icon-list-icon i {color: #000;transition: color .3s;}
.elementor-13 .elementor-element.elementor-element-803edf7 .elementor-icon-list-icon svg {fill: #000;transition: fill .3s;}
.elementor-13 .elementor-element.elementor-element-803edf7 .elementor-icon-list-item > .elementor-icon-list-text, .elementor-13 .elementor-element.elementor-element-803edf7 .elementor-icon-list-item > a {font-family: "Rajdhani",Sans-serif;font-size: 20px;font-weight: 600;}
.elementor-13 .elementor-element.elementor-element-803edf7 .elementor-icon-list-text {color: #000;transition: color .3s;}
.elementor-13 .elementor-element.elementor-element-9bd71c4 {--display: flex;--flex-direction: column;--container-widget-width: 100%;--container-widget-height: initial;--container-widget-flex-grow: 0;--container-widget-align-self: initial;--flex-wrap-mobile: wrap;}
.elementor-13 .elementor-element.elementor-element-8c8aa7b {text-align: center;}
.elementor-13 .elementor-element.elementor-element-8c8aa7b .elementor-heading-title {font-family: "Rajdhani",Sans-serif;font-size: 36px;font-weight: 600;color: #000;}
.elementor-13 .elementor-element.elementor-element-3f8a431 {--display: flex;--flex-direction: column;--container-widget-width: 100%;--container-widget-height: initial;--container-widget-flex-grow: 0;--container-widget-align-self: initial;--flex-wrap-mobile: wrap;}
.elementor-widget-button .elementor-button {background-color: var(--e-global-color-accent);font-family: var(--e-global-typography-accent-font-family),Sans-serif;font-weight: var(--e-global-typography-accent-font-weight);}
.elementor-13 .elementor-element.elementor-element-44c0aed .elementor-button {background-color: var(--e-global-color-primary);}
@media (max-width:767px) {.elementor-13 .elementor-element.elementor-element-8376cf5 {text-align: left;}}
@media (min-width:768px) {.elementor-13 .elementor-element.elementor-element-c6832b6 {--width: 25%;}
	.elementor-13 .elementor-element.elementor-element-9bd71c4 {--width: 50%;}
	.elementor-13 .elementor-element.elementor-element-3f8a431 {--width: 25%;}}